dc.description.abstracten | This work is devoted to proving the global existence of weak solution for a general
isothermal model of capillary fluids derived in his modern form by C. Rohde in [21],
which can be used as a phase transition model. First, inspired by the result by P.-L.
Lions in [19] on the Navier- Stokes compressible system we show the global stability of
weak solutions for our system with is entropic pressure and next with general pressure.
Finally, we consider perturbations of a stable equilibrium. | en |
